Cancer&Entry Information
Cancer Name | esophageal squamous cell carcinoma |
ICD-0-3 | NA |
Methods | RT-qPCR, Western blot analysis, Dual luciferase reporter gene assay |
Sample | ESCC tissues,ESCC cell TE-1 |
Expression Pattern | down-regulated |
Function Description | underexpressed GAS5 and RECK, and overexpressed miR-21 in ESCC. GAS5 elevation and miR-21 inhibition reduced viability and the colony formation ability, and enhanced the apoptosis of ESCC cells under radiation.GAS5 elevation up-regulates RECK expression by down-regulating miR-21 to increase ESCC cell apoptosis after radiation therapy, thus enhancing cell radio-sensitivity. |
Pubmed ID | 31866421 |
Year | 2020 |
Title | Elevation of Long Non-Coding RNA GAS5 and Knockdown of microRNA-21 Up-Regulate RECK Expression to Enhance Esophageal Squamous Cell Carcinoma Cell Radio-Sensitivity After Radiotherapy |
